Chapter 5 A proposal In Need..

scarlette's~~~~

He yelled it straight into my face, each word hitting like a slap, sharp and deliberate. I could feel my ears ringing from how loud it was.

My breath hitched.

Slowly, I pulled my hands back from his grasp, even though they throbbed with pain. I wiped my face with the back of my hand, brushing the tears away.

But the crack inside me had already split wide open.

And at that moment, something inside me broke. Not the kind that leaves you shattered-but the kind that hardens you forever.

I laughed bitterly, pain mixing with rage. "You're insane, Ethan. After all these years, after everything I gave you, everything I sacrificed-you're throwing me away like trash? How do you expect anyone to even look at me again? To want me?"

He smirked.

"I don't give a damn. You're already worthless. Used up. Don't even dream of remarriage. No one wants leftovers."

But then, a voice cut through the air like thunder.

"I'll marry her, brother."

We all froze.

I turned, my heart skipping.

Liam.

What the hell are you saying?" Mother barked, storming toward him.

"Have you lost your mind? Marry her? A woman your brother is rejecting and divorcing?"

Liam stepped past her like she was air, stopping in front of me. His eyes were calm, unreadable, but focused on me-not the mess around us.

"Scarlette," he said softly, "sign the divorce papers. And marry me instead."

My brain scrambled. My heart raced.

Was this a game? A twisted joke?

Divorcing Ethan and agreeing to marry his younger brother... wasn't something I ever imagined-not in a million lifetimes.

But remaining in this house... in this family... and destroying every single person who looked down on me? That... that was a temptation I could taste.

"Liam... what are you doing?" My voice came out low, shaky. I took a small step back, but he didn't move. His eyes were steady-too steady. "Do you even understand what you just said?" I asked, trying to breathe.

He just looked at me.

"The society... your family... Ethan-" I swallowed hard, my throat burning. "I won't just be your brother's ex-wife. I'm older than you, Liam. People will talk. They'll shame you."

My eyes started to sting again, threatening more tears. I hated that I still cared what anyone thought, but I did. I always had.

He took a step closer. His voice came out soft, but firm. "Who cares, Scarlette?"

I blinked.

"You've been good to everyone here. Too good," he said, his jaw clenching. "No one deserves you. Not Ethan. Not this family. If they don't want you..." He moved even closer, his face inches from mine, eyes burning with something I couldn't name.

"I want you. As my wife."

I couldn't speak.

My heart pounded so loud it filled the silence between us.

He wasn't joking. He meant every damn word.

And for the first time in years, I didn't know whether to cry... or run.

I stared at him-this boy, this man, standing in front of me with a promise I never thought I'd hear again.

They don't know.

No one really knows what I gave up.

I didn't marry Ethan because he was rich. I married him because I thought he saw me. Because for once, someone chose me..not for what I could give, but for who I was.

I gave him my everything. My time, my youth... my body, even when it ached with hope that never came. When the doctors said the problem was mine, I bore the shame in silence. I swallowed every bitter look from his mother, every hushed conversation about my womb being too tired..or too empty.

I smiled through all of it. For love.

And Emelia... my own sister. I took her in when she had no one. Paid for her school. Got her a job. I stood by her when our parents called her a disgrace. I made Ethan give her a chance in the company. I trusted her.

How stupid of me.

Now here I was, standing in the same house that watched me burn while her perfume still lingered on Ethan's clothes. And yet this boy... no, this man, Liam... was saying the very thing I thought I'd die never hearing again.

"I want you. As my wife."

"Liam, what the fuck do you think you're doing?!" Ethan yelled, rage rising.

Liam didn't blink. His eyes never left mine.

"Scarlette. What are you waiting for?" he asked again, calm, but firm.

I reached into my bag And Pulled out a pen.

Signed the divorce papers with steady hands.

Then turned to Liam.

"Let's get married," I said, grabbing his hand.

A slow fire lit inside me.

I will stay in this mansion as the ex-wife of the first Newton son... and the new wife of the second.

Just when I was about to walk away, his hand grabbed my arm tight, rough, like he had any right left.

"You've gone insane! This.... this is wrong! All of it is damn wrong!" Ethan barked behind me, his voice shaking with something between anger and disbelief. Frustration creased his forehead, his chest rising and falling like he'd just been hit.

I turned slowly, just halfway up the stairs. I didn't flinch. I didn't lower my eyes like I used to.

"Oh?" I asked, arching my brow. "Now it's wrong?"

He looked at me like I'd betrayed him. Him. The audacity.

"Why?" I asked with a cruel little smirk playing on my lips. "You can bring in another woman. Call her your wife. Divorce me like I'm trash. But I can't do the same? I can't marry your brother?"

His jaw clenched. Silence.

"You know what's really insane, Ethan?" I tilted my head. "That you still think you have a say in my life after what you did. That you think I should crawl away quietly and just take the hit. Like I don't bleed."

He stepped forward, his eyes dark, fists clenched. "This family will never accept you again. Not after this. You've ruined yourself."

I laughed-short, bitter.

"No, you ruined me."

His eyes darted away for a second. Guilt? Maybe. But not enough to matter now.

I took a deep breath and stood tall, my voice calm, sharp as a knife.

"It's settled, Ethan. I signed your damn divorce. And now I'm marrying Liam. So whatever you think, whatever you feel-keep it. I'm done listening."

And with that, I turned and climbed the stairs, each step louder than his silence.

Behind me, I heard Emelia calling his name. Heard his footsteps freeze.

Let them stay down there in their perfect mess.

Because henceforth?

I wasn't the discarded wife anymore.
